VB6.0动态菜单设计教程:数组操作与实时扩展

需积分: 16 1 下载量 194 浏览量 更新于2024-08-17 收藏 3.47MB PPT 举报
动态菜单的设计是VB6.0中一项实用的功能,主要用于构建交互式用户界面。在这个教程中,主要讲解了如何利用VB6.0的菜单编辑器来创建动态菜单。首先,通过设置“标题”和“名称”,例如mnuRecentFile(0),创建数组中的第一个菜单项,并将其索引设为0。接着,在相同的缩进级别上添加第二个菜单项,使其名称与第一个相同但索引为1,以此类推,实现菜单的动态扩展。 当用户首次存储文件时,系统会在菜单中自动添加一个分隔符,然后将第一个文件名显示出来。每次存储新文件,都会自动在菜单中增加一个新的子菜单,反映出用户的操作历史。为了管理和控制这些动态生成的控件,可以通过Hide方法或设置Visible属性为False来隐藏,而Unload语句用于从内存中移除不再需要的控件。 这个教程涉及到的VB6.0课程内容广泛,包括但不限于VB基本语法结构、程序基本控制流程、数组、过程、常用控件、界面设计与窗体、多窗体与多文档界面以及文件操作。特别是面向对象的编程,如事件驱动编程机制和对数据库的强大支持,这些都是VB6.0作为面向对象语言的重要特性。此外,安装和启动VisualBasic6.0也是学习过程中不可或缺的一部分,介绍了如何通过向导进行安装,并简述了程序的启动和退出流程。 在学习动态菜单设计的同时,学员会深入理解VB6.0的编程理念,如其图形用户界面的友好性、多任务处理能力、以及与其他系统资源的共享,这些都是Windows环境下的编程优势。通过这样的实践,学生能够提升编程技能,更好地应用VB6.0进行应用程序的开发。